Death doesn't kill you (and other reasons to study behaviour change)
Published 13 February 2017
This is a talk I gave to a group of master’s students in social psychology. It introduces the crisis of confidence in science, how non-communicable diseases can be thought of as symptom networks, and some basics of behaviour change research.
